Transaction 5ae2ec8917fc95460c342c0d13e742a64a745d91c3cbf3857179f46980c04fbb

1 Input
2 Outputs
  • 5ae2ec8917fc95460c342c0d13e742a64a745d91c3cbf3857179f46980c04fbb:0
  • value  12900000
    address  3AhLevmPp3JQdRUv7WLzaZnDTkFyR1ac7t
  • 5ae2ec8917fc95460c342c0d13e742a64a745d91c3cbf3857179f46980c04fbb:1
  • value  1645426272
    address  3FSj5an4Ntf8qcKX6Hyj9ECSBVFBnqXARQ